Brian Johnstone

A Scottishpoet whose poems ‘evoke…a sense of spiritual immanence in their slow stillspaces’ (Scottish Literary Journal)while being ‘full of stilled moments and nicely shaped incidents’ (Scotland on Sunday). His work hasappeared throughout Scotland, in England, America and in various Europeancountries.

The Battle of Maldon

“In this translation I attempt torecreate “The Battle of Maldon” as faithfully as possible while roughly imitatingthe original meter and including the alliteration that both defines theAnglo-Saxon verse line and creates its unique music. Though the beginning andend have been lost, the poem is probably nearly complete.”

Translation and Introduction
byMarijane Osborn
